Inertia describes a tendency of an object to do nothing, so you might be confused why the Gregory Inertia 15L 3D-Hydro Reservoir Backpack is the perfect thing for your always-active lifestyle. Well that confusion should clear right up once you put it on. It's designed with a supportive and comfortable suspension system that features breathable foam shoulder and hip straps, a breathable back panel, and load lifters at the yoke that adjust the pack closer to the body for a more supportive carry. Included in the pack is a 3L hydration reservoir that sits securely in its own pocket, and features an easy SpeedClip mounting system that makes it easy to install and remove the bladder.
When you need to reach for a windbreaker or rain shell you've got a buckled stretch mesh pocket that stores layers easily, as well as two stretch mesh side pockets in case you'd rather forgo the hydration system in favor of some good old fashioned water bottles. And the storage doesn't stop there thanks to the stowable trekking pole carrying system that'll help you fkeep your hands free on rocky summit slopes. There's also a convenient sunglass storage system on the shoulder straps, keeping your shades safe in a scratch-free environment without you having to take off your pack to stow them.

Selecting an option will reload the available reviews on the pageSeptember 15, 2022
Well-designed with lots of small but useful featur
Good size, nice H20 bladder (included!), good adjustments. Lacks trekking pole loops of bigger Inertia models. Small pocket is padded and has key clip, but larger pocket with dividers, organizers (e.g. inner pockets, zipped mesh pocket) would have made a perfect commuter day pack PLUS day hiker/hydration pack. Outer bottle pockets well-designed -- deep, elastic, plus works well w side compression straps to hold bottles securely.

[This review was collected as part of a promotion.] I had high hopes for this bag but wasn't impressed. The bag does include a 3L reservoir which is great but the alleged "breathable back panel" didn't ventilate any better than other bags I've owned, the one small, plush-lined pocket doesn't have any dividers so anything you place in there will move around anyway, it does not have the trekking poll attachments that the 20 L has, and the chest strap has very little vertical isolation in terms of fit for the user with a longer torso.
